summary refs log tree commit diff
path: root/pkgs/build-support/cc-wrapper
diff options
context:
space:
mode:
authorFranz Pletz <fpletz@fnordicwalking.de>2016-03-07 01:29:11 +0100
committerFranz Pletz <fpletz@fnordicwalking.de>2016-03-07 01:30:40 +0100
commitb2b499e6c40a36ff8cdbfd8d27096592d0f394cb (patch)
treeecd16e7533732c1424dbd851cb4fb31c66207834 /pkgs/build-support/cc-wrapper
parentab1092875a6292e6fc5fb34d48436cf02374e00c (diff)
downloadnixlib-b2b499e6c40a36ff8cdbfd8d27096592d0f394cb.tar
nixlib-b2b499e6c40a36ff8cdbfd8d27096592d0f394cb.tar.gz
nixlib-b2b499e6c40a36ff8cdbfd8d27096592d0f394cb.tar.bz2
nixlib-b2b499e6c40a36ff8cdbfd8d27096592d0f394cb.tar.lz
nixlib-b2b499e6c40a36ff8cdbfd8d27096592d0f394cb.tar.xz
nixlib-b2b499e6c40a36ff8cdbfd8d27096592d0f394cb.tar.zst
nixlib-b2b499e6c40a36ff8cdbfd8d27096592d0f394cb.zip
cc-wrapper: Increase number of functions for stackprotector
Diffstat (limited to 'pkgs/build-support/cc-wrapper')
-rw-r--r--pkgs/build-support/cc-wrapper/add-hardening2
1 files changed, 1 insertions, 1 deletions
diff --git a/pkgs/build-support/cc-wrapper/add-hardening b/pkgs/build-support/cc-wrapper/add-hardening
index 92e10db3ea48..966d68e1948e 100644
--- a/pkgs/build-support/cc-wrapper/add-hardening
+++ b/pkgs/build-support/cc-wrapper/add-hardening
@@ -12,7 +12,7 @@ if [[ ! $hardeningDisable == "all" ]]; then
           hardeningCFlags+=('-O2' '-D_FORTIFY_SOURCE=2')
           ;;
         stackprotector)
-          hardeningCFlags+=('-fstack-protector-strong')
+          hardeningCFlags+=('-fstack-protector-strong' '--param ssp-buffer-size=4')
           ;;
         pie)
           hardeningCFlags+=('-fPIE')